The overview below groups typical Sink Pipe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grove City,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sink pipe repairs in Grove City, OH range from $150 to $400. Many routine fixes, such as sealing leaks or replacing a section of pipe,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more but are less common.
Moderate Repairs - For moderate repairs involving multiple pipe sections or fixture replacements, local contractors often charge between $400 and $1,200. These projects are fairly common and usually involve replacing corroded or damaged pipes.
Full Pipe Replacement - Complete sink pipe replacements in Grove City typically cost between $1,200 and $3,000. Larger, more involved projects, such as replacing entire plumbing runs, can reach $3,500 or more, but these are less frequent.
Complex or Emergency Jobs - Extensive or urgent sink pipe repairs, including dealing with severe leaks or obstructions, can range from $3,000 to $5,000+ depending on the scope. Such projects are less common and usually require specialized services from local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a sink pipe needs repair? Signs include frequent clogs, slow draining, unpleasant odors, and visible leaks under the sink.
How can local contractors fix a leaking sink pipe? They typically inspect the pipe, identify the leak source, and replace or seal damaged sections to prevent further water damage.
What causes sink pipes to become damaged or clogged? Causes include accumulated debris, corrosion, improper installation, and tree root intrusion in nearby plumbing lines.
Are there preventive measures to avoid sink pipe issues? Regular inspections, avoiding pouring grease or large debris down the drain, and timely repairs can help prevent problems.
